Elk City's hot summers and unpredictable winters put extra stress on water heaters throughout Beckham County. The extreme temperature swings cause expansion and contraction of metal components, while Oklahoma's notoriously hard water—rich in calcium and magnesium from the Ogallala Aquifer—accelerates sediment buildup and tank corrosion. Homeowners in western Oklahoma face unique challenges that make professional water heater maintenance essential.

Common water heater problems in Elk City include rapid sediment accumulation, failing anode rods, temperature pressure relief valve issues, and scaling on heating elements. These issues are compounded by mineral-rich water that leaves deposits reducing efficiency by up to 30%. Whether you're in an older downtown home or a newer development near Interstate 40, understanding these local factors helps prevent unexpected cold showers and costly emergency repairs.

Elk City residents face distinct water heater challenges due to the region's geology and climate. The local water supply contains high levels of dissolved minerals, with hardness levels often exceeding 180 ppm—well above the national average. This hard water creates scale buildup that insulates heating elements, forcing water heaters to work harder and consume more energy. Older neighborhoods near Historic Route 66 and downtown Elk City frequently have aging water heaters that are 10-15 years old, well past their prime in these harsh water conditions. The variable winters, with temperatures occasionally dropping below freezing, also put additional strain on water heater components and plumbing connections.

Most homes in Elk City use traditional tank-style water heaters from brands like Rheem, AO Smith, and Bradford White, though tankless installations are increasing in popularity for their energy efficiency. Properties in areas like Cedar Lake or near Western Oklahoma State College can benefit from upgraded units designed for hard water conditions. In Elk City's mineral-rich water, traditional tank water heaters typically last 8-12 years instead of the standard 10-15. Hard water accelerates tank corrosion and sediment buildup. Regular annual maintenance including flushing and anode rod inspection can extend lifespan by 3-5 years. Tankless units often last 15-20 years with proper descaling.

Elk City's variable winters cause metal components to contract in cold temperatures, stressing connections and valves. When water heaters work harder to heat colder incoming water, existing weaknesses become failures. Poor insulation in garages or crawl spaces increases risk. We recommend insulation blankets and checking temperature settings before winter arrives.

With Beckham County's hard water exceeding 180 ppm, flush your water heater every 6-12 months. Homes with softeners can extend to annually. Flushing removes sediment that reduces efficiency and causes premature failure. Professional flushing includes component inspection and is more thorough than DIY methods, especially for maintaining manufacturer warranties.

Replace your Elk City water heater if it's over 10 years old, produces rusty water, makes loud rumbling noises from sediment, leaks from the tank, or requires frequent repairs.
